The Dance Program at Middleburyemphasizes creation and performance of original dance work by students and faculty. Two full-time faculty, an artist-in-residence, a lighting designer and technical director, a music director and accompanists, and adjunct staff for specific techniques comprise our dance staff. Residencies throughout the year by visiting artists further extend educational diversity. Visits by professional choreographers, performers, and teachers from all over the world expand our horizons intellectually, artistically, and culturally.
